TS3-75 is a versatile electronic component that belongs to the category of voltage regulators. It is widely used in various electronic devices to regulate and stabilize voltage levels, ensuring consistent and reliable performance.
The TS3-75 regulator typically features three pins: 1. Input (VIN): Connects to the input voltage source 2. Ground (GND): Connected to the ground reference 3. Output (VOUT): Provides the regulated output voltage
The TS3-75 utilizes a feedback control mechanism to maintain a constant output voltage despite variations in the input voltage and load conditions. This is achieved through an internal error amplifier and a pass transistor that adjusts the output voltage as needed.
